The other day, Tvtas skydas 2 ("Durable Shield — 2") exercises started in Lithuania. They take place near the Suwalki corridor and the Kaliningrad region of Russia. About a thousand military personnel are taking part in the maneuvers, as well as several hundred militia members from the Volunteer Forces for the Protection of the Region (KASP). This organization consists mainly of members of the Lithuanian Riflemen's Union, a paramilitary association where civilians are trained in self-defense and guerrilla methods.

Judging by the legend and geography of the exercises, Lithuanian citizens will be trained for "partisanship" in the area of the Suwalki corridor. This is a narrow stretch of territory on the Lithuanian-Polish border between Belarus and the Kaliningrad Region, with a length of about 64 kilometers. This corridor alone connects the Baltic states overland with the rest of Europe and NATO. The North Atlantic Alliance believes that Russia may try to take control of it in order to break through the shortest land route to Kaliningrad.

To counter the perceived threat, fortifications and regular army exercises have been actively built in the Suwalki corridor for several years. And last year they came up with the idea to attract volunteers — they are destined to play the role of partisans and saboteurs.

The air front

On June 8, NATO began large-scale military exercises of the Ramstein Flag 2026 Air Force. This is the third time that the training events have been held, with representatives from 19 countries participating. The main stages of the maneuvers are taking place in Denmark, Finland, Norway, Sweden and Spain. According to the Joint Command of the NATO Air Force, about 150 sorties are carried out per day. There is a Boeing E-3A Sentry "flying radar" among the one and a half hundred wings. In total, about 1,800 military personnel are participating in the exercises.

The allies are practicing joint actions of aviation from different states, training to transfer forces and assets to different directions in order, as officially stated, "to confirm the readiness of countries to activate the fifth article of the NATO Charter on collective defense." Special emphasis will be placed on air defense. NATO is also working on the naval component of the joint forces. The BALTOPS exercises of the North Atlantic Alliance have started in the Baltic Sea. About 20 ships and about nine thousand military personnel from 16 countries are taking part in them: the USA, Great Britain, Germany, France, Poland, Sweden, Finland, Denmark, Norway, the Netherlands, Belgium, Lithuania, Latvia, Estonia, Portugal and Turkey. The maneuvers are led by the Sixth Fleet of the US Navy.

NATO ships in the Baltic Sea during the BALTOPS exercises

Image source: © Photo : U.S. Navy / Petty Officer 2nd Class Mario Coto

The training began in the western part of the Baltic and is gradually shifting to the east, where the Allies are working to supply and protect the sea lanes around the Swedish island of Gotland. Evacuation, mine clearance, amphibious operations are carried out near the Kaliningrad region, and unmanned sea boats are actively used.

"We have three major tasks ahead of us: deterring Russian threats in the Baltic Sea region, increasing real readiness and interoperability, and strengthening alliance cohesion," said Lieutenant General John Meade, Deputy Commander of the Brunssum Joint Task Force.
